Transaction ed66b81d77be2686e4c2e34ba5ce570543462de3f3e2d4f9150c41ffc4ca7314

1 Input
2 Outputs
  • ed66b81d77be2686e4c2e34ba5ce570543462de3f3e2d4f9150c41ffc4ca7314:0
  • value  1025626
    address  3FD4V7FFdu4TXkiV3qdRHDWzEiq6LBrQvS
  • ed66b81d77be2686e4c2e34ba5ce570543462de3f3e2d4f9150c41ffc4ca7314:1
  • value  107370
    address  15PsyQmcM4nBWToxgiuuy5BPPxDM1TYrbx